@font-face{
  font-family:"Hatton";
  src:url("//strassenmuehle.com/cdn/shop/t/7/assets/PPHatton-Medium.woff2?v=6776181006442715651767773408") format("woff2");
  font-weight:400;
  font-style:normal;
  font-display:swap;
}
@font-face{
  font-family:"Hatton";
  src:url("//strassenmuehle.com/cdn/shop/t/7/assets/Hatton-Bold.woff2?v=3377") format("woff2");
  font-weight:700;
  font-style:normal;
  font-display:swap;
}

:root{
  --font-paragraph--family:"Hatton", system-ui, sans-serif;
  --font-h1--family:"Hatton", system-ui, sans-serif;
  --font-h2--family:"Hatton", system-ui, sans-serif;

  --font-body-family:"Hatton", system-ui, sans-serif;
  --font-heading-family:"Hatton", system-ui, sans-serif;
}